Barter Settlement is a locality in Charlotte, New Brunswick, Canada. It is classified as a small locality. Barter Settlement is located at 45.2060°N, 67.3375°W. It observes Atlantic Time (UTC−4 / −3). Postal code area: E3L.
Barter Settlement rests quietly upon the rising slopes of Haleys Hill, where the land leans toward the St. Croix River. It lies 4.3 km north-west of St. Stephen, NB (from St. Stephen, NB: bearing 312°T), and is situated 10.6 km south-south-west of Moores Mills.
